You can read each therapist’s profile, see how they present themselves and whether you feel comfy with them and what they offer. When you find someone you like, all you have to do is click the ‘Get going’ button and you will be prompted to pay and get the treatment rolling.
Payments are made on a month-to-month basis, and there’s only one plan to pick from. As pointed out above, you get limitless texting and one live session a week. The cost varies between $90 and $120 weekly– depending upon your location and asked for treatment. You can pay with either credit/ debit card or Paypal.
Throughout the preliminary signup questionnaire, you can specify if you are presently unemployed or dealing with any kind of monetary problems. When the payment screen appears, there will be a link on it saying ‘Make an application for financial assistance’– you can click it to learn if you are qualified for their program or not. You’ll be asked a couple of concerns and provided discount rates based on the info you offer– with the biggest discount rate being 40% off the initial price.
As tragic as it may be, it is estimated that over 14 million guys in the United States experience distressed or depressive ideas daily, and significantly more men experience a minimum of one depressive episode, approximated at 30.6% of the men in the US. In addition, regardless of rates of depression showing higher in females than men, there is a * 4x higher rate of suicide in males. These numbers are remarkably and scarily high; without help and change, they will keep climbing up.
* If you or a liked one is experiencing self-destructive thoughts, reach out for help instantly. The National Suicide Prevention Lifeline can be reached at 988 and is offered 24/7.
